Stella Everett is a rising American actress known for her work in film, television, and theater. With a strong background in stage performance, she brings natural, emotionally grounded acting to screen roles. Her growing career reflects versatility, as she continues to appear in modern TV series and films, gaining attention for her subtle and authentic performance style.

From Stage to Screen: The Expanding Career of Stella Everett

Like many accomplished actors, Stella Everett’s journey is closely tied to the discipline of stage performance. Theatre remains one of the most demanding environments for actors, requiring consistent emotional control, vocal precision, and the ability to maintain character continuity in real time. This foundation often translates into stronger screen presence, and Everett’s work reflects that training.

Transitioning from stage to screen is not always seamless, as the two mediums demand different techniques. Theatre acting often requires broader physical expression and vocal projection, while screen acting focuses on subtlety and controlled emotional delivery. Everett’s ability to navigate both worlds demonstrates a flexible skill set that is increasingly valuable in today’s entertainment industry.

On stage, she is known for her commitment to character immersion, often focusing on emotional truth rather than performative exaggeration. This discipline carries over into her screen roles, where even minimal gestures or expressions feel intentional and meaningful.

In television and film environments, where production schedules are fast-paced and scenes are frequently shot out of sequence, actors must maintain emotional consistency. Everett’s background helps her adapt quickly, ensuring that her performances remain coherent and grounded regardless of production challenges.

Her career progression also reflects a broader trend in the industry: the blending of theatre-trained actors into mainstream screen roles. Casting directors often seek performers who can deliver depth without relying heavily on post-production enhancement, and Everett fits that profile naturally.

As she continues to expand her portfolio, her ability to move between stage and screen positions her as a versatile performer capable of long-term growth in multiple directions of the entertainment world.
